  6. I would suggest a cheap cover from Ghostbikes or Aldi. I find the expensive covers are hard to get on and off due to the elastic they use and they trap damp inside. Cheap covers may let some water in, but they dry our far quicker. The Ghostbikes one I have used gives me about 18 months before I need a new one, which was about the same time as more expensive covers from R&G and Oxford.
  7. It is mandatory if there is a standard 20 mph speed limit sign. It is not mandatory if the sign includes lights to flash and a warning the 20 mph speed limit only applies when the lights flash. What caught me out was at the mandatory limit, on one approach only, there is another sign which flashes up your speed (or should do). During my test we approached the limit from that side and my brain told me that since the first limit did not apply as no lights were flashing, since the speed sign did not react at the second limit, I was OK to keep going there at 30 mph as well.

  11. IME "waterproofing" sprays etc only extend the time before boots start to leak. The same applies to gloves, jackets and trousers (and tents). If you want actual waterproof, buy Goretex. That is the only thing which will prevent getting wet in heavy, extended rain.
